👨‍🏫 MEET YOUR INSTRUCTOR

Franklin Ritch is an award-winning filmmaker, writer, and director.

His debut feature film The Artifice Girl premiered at the Fantasia International Film Festival, where it won the Golden Audience Award, and went on to receive top honors internationally.

He has been named one of Filmmaker Magazine’s “25 New Faces of Independent Film” and is known for making complex storytelling feel clear, practical, and accessible for beginners.
